⚖ Cybersquatting in Malaysia is defined and governed under Malaysian Network Information Centre Berhad (“MYNIC”), an agency under the Ministry of Science, Technology and Innovation. You can learn more about MYNIC at https://mynic.my/about/about-mynic/.
